Russia has launched a submarine designed to carry the nuclear-powered, nuclear-armed Poseidon torpedo, which Moscow says will ensure the country's maritime security.
The submarine , named Khabarovsk , is classified as a "heavy nuclear-powered missile cruiser," the state-run Tass news agency reported. Russian Defense Minister Andrey Belousov said the launch ceremony was a significant event for the Russian military .

Why It Matters
Last week, Russian President Vladimir Putin announced that the Poseidon torpedo had been successfully tested, claiming the weapon is unlike any other in the world and has far greater power than the country's most advanced intercontinental ballistic missiles.
